Shadowsocks Ubuntu 20.04 安装与配置教程

目录

  1. 介绍
  2. 安装
  3. 配置
  4. 测试
  5. 常见问题解答

1. 介绍

Shadowsocks是一种基于SOCKS5代理协议的加密传输工具,可以帮助用户在网络上实现加密通信和突破网络封锁。本文将指导您在Ubuntu 20.04上安装和配置Shadowsocks。

2. 安装

以下是在Ubuntu 20.04上安装Shadowsocks的步骤:

  • 打开终端
  • 运行以下命令以更新软件包列表:

sudo apt update

  • 安装Shadowsocks软件:

sudo apt install shadowsocks-libev

3. 配置

完成安装后,您需要进行Shadowsocks的配置。以下是配置文件的示例:

{ “server”:”your_server_ip”, “server_port”:your_server_port, “password”:”your_password”, “method”:”your_encryption_method”, “timeout”:300}

4. 测试

要测试Shadowsocks是否成功配置,请按照以下步骤进行:

  • 启动Shadowsocks服务:

sudo systemctl start shadowsocks-libev

  • 检查Shadowsocks服务状态:

sudo systemctl status shadowsocks-libev

  • 使用Shadowsocks客户端连接到服务器并验证连接是否成功。

5. 常见问题解答

Q1: 如何安装Shadowsocks客户端?

  • 使用apt安装:

sudo apt install shadowsocks-libev

  • 手动下载并安装:

在Shadowsocks官方网站上下载适用于您的操作系统的客户端,并按照说明进行安装。

Q2: 如何修改Shadowsocks的配置文件?

  • 使用文本编辑器打开配置文件:

sudo nano /etc/shadowsocks-libev/config.json

  • 修改配置文件中的相关参数,并保存更改。

Q3: 如何卸载Shadowsocks?

  • 停止Shadowsocks服务:

sudo systemctl stop shadowsocks-libev

  • 卸载Shadowsocks软件:

sudo apt remove shadowsocks-libev

以上是一些常见问题的解答,希望能帮助您顺利安装和配置Shadowsocks。

正文完